Rewards are proportional to your balance — the more LTHN you hold, the more frequently you'll earn PoS blocks. + +| Metric | Value | +|--------|-------| +| Block reward | 1 LTHN | +| Block time | ~120 seconds | +| PoS blocks per day | ~720 | +| Minimum stake | Any amount (no minimum) | +| Lock time | None (stake and spend freely) | + +## Backup Your Wallet + +```bash +docker compose -f docker-compose.node.yml stop wallet +docker cp lthn-wallet:/wallet ./wallet-backup-$(date +%Y%m%d) +docker compose -f docker-compose.node.yml start wallet +``` + +**Keep your wallet backup safe.** If you lose it, you lose your LTHN. + +## Stopping + +```bash +docker compose -f docker-compose.node.yml down # stop (keeps data) +docker compose -f docker-compose.node.yml down -v # stop + delete everything +``` diff --git a/Run-an-Exit-Node.md b/Run-an-Exit-Node.md new file mode 100644 index 0000000..9a40f07 --- /dev/null +++ b/Run-an-Exit-Node.md @@ -0,0 +1,129 @@ +# Run a VPN Exit Node + +Earn LTHN by providing bandwidth to the Lethean dVPN network. + +## How It Works + +1. You run a WireGuard VPN server on your home connection +2. Your node registers itself on the Lethean blockchain +3. Gateway nodes discover your exit node and route VPN traffic through it +4. You earn LTHN for every session served + +``` +VPN User → Gateway → [encrypted tunnel] → Your Exit Node → Internet +``` + +## What You Get + +- Full chain node with PoS staking rewards +- WireGuard VPN exit server +- Automatic gateway peering via on-chain discovery +- LTHN earnings from bandwidth + staking + +## Requirements + +- Linux with Docker installed +- **Public IP address** (or port forwarding on your router) +- Open ports: **46942 TCP** (P2P) and **51820 UDP** (WireGuard) +- 2GB RAM, 10GB disk space +- Stable internet connection + +## Quick Start + +```bash +# Download compose and config +curl -O https://forge.lthn.ai/lthn/blockchain/raw/branch/dev/docker/docker-compose.exit.yml +curl -O https://forge.lthn.ai/lthn/blockchain/raw/branch/dev/docker/.env.example + +# Configure +cp .env.example .env +``` + +Edit `.env` with your details: + +```bash +WALLET_PASSWORD=your-secure-password +EXIT_PUBLIC_IP=203.0.113.50 # Your public IP +EXIT_NAME=my-exit # Your node name (optional) +EXIT_MAX_PEERS=25 # Max simultaneous VPN users +``` + +Start: + +```bash +docker compose -f docker-compose.exit.yml up -d +``` + +## Check Status + +```bash +# Controller logs (shows height, balance, peers) +docker logs lthn-exit-controller --tail 10 + +# WireGuard status +docker exec lthn-exit-wireguard wg show + +# Wallet balance +curl -s http://localhost:46944/json_rpc \ + -d '{"jsonrpc":"2.0","id":"0","method":"getbalance"}' \ + -H 'Content-Type: application/json' +``` + +## Router Setup + +Open these ports on your home router: + +| Port | Protocol | Service | +|------|----------|---------| +| 46942 | TCP | Chain P2P (node peering) | +| 51820 | UDP | WireGuard VPN | + +### Finding Your Public IP + +```bash +curl -s ifconfig.me +``` + +Use this IP as `EXIT_PUBLIC_IP` in your `.env`. + +## On-Chain Registration + +When your wallet has at least 1 LTHN, the exit node can register an on-chain alias. This makes your node discoverable by gateways. + +The alias comment follows the Lethean service discovery protocol: + +``` +v=lthn1;type=exit;cap=vpn,proxy;ip=YOUR_PUBLIC_IP +``` + +Gateways query the chain for aliases with `type=exit` and route VPN sessions to your node. + +## Earnings + +| Source | How | +|--------|-----| +| PoS staking | Automatic — proportional to balance | +| VPN bandwidth | Per-session payments from gateways | +| Block rewards | Optional — connect a GPU miner | + +## Security + +- VPN traffic passes through your internet connection. You are the exit point. +- WireGuard encrypts all tunnel traffic between gateway and your node. +- The controller never exposes your wallet keys. +- Your ISP sees generic encrypted UDP traffic (WireGuard), not the tunnelled content. + +## Backup + +```bash +docker compose -f docker-compose.exit.yml stop wallet +docker cp lthn-exit-wallet:/wallet ./wallet-backup-$(date +%Y%m%d) +docker compose -f docker-compose.exit.yml start wallet +``` + +## Stopping + +```bash +docker compose -f docker-compose.exit.yml down # stop (keeps data) +docker compose -f docker-compose.exit.yml down -v # stop + delete everything +```
